Good that your company has learned from the AF accident. I was in the sim 2 months ago, and still doing stalls at 5000ft by chopping the power and watching the speed bleed off.
You've presented an interesting scenario. No doubt the ASI indication of 30kt was due to icing, and the resulting error in the wind readout when the TAS is compared to GS.
A 15000ft loss in altitude is certainly eye opening. I still wonder why some airlines (including my own) still want us to maintain altitude during a stall recovery